BUSINESS<br />
Aerosol & Dispensing Forum in New York<br />
Colep exhibited at the first ever Aerosol & Dispensing Forum<br />
in New York on 13th & 14th of September, launching its<br />
innovation offer to the US market and showcasing its knowhow<br />
in aerosol technology from its site in Mexico.<br />
Santiago de Querétaro is the fastest growing city in Mexico<br />
for logistics and manufacturing, as well as a centre of enterprise<br />
and economic development, due to its established<br />
supply chain and well-developed road and freight transport<br />
networks leading to Mexico City – the gateway to North<br />
America. The region is industry-rich thanks to its membership<br />
of the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A),<br />
which encourages free trade throughout Mexico, USA and<br />
Canada, with emphasis on removal of borders and the free<br />
movement of people, to achieve its economic integration<br />
goals.<br />
At the two-day event, that welcomed global brand owners<br />
and suppliers as well as key players from the US market,<br />
Jo Jackson (Marketing & Innovation Manager) presented<br />
“What’s trending in Europe”, focusing on the European<br />
trends that are currently shaping the Personal Care and,<br />
specifically, the aerosol industry.<br />
We are looking forward to transferring our expertise<br />
and know-how in aerosol technology to the US market<br />
through our plant in Mexico.<br />
Paulo Sousa, Sales Director for the Americas<br />
Colep has initiated its operations in Mexico in 2013 with the<br />
acquisition of a plant in Santiago de Querétaro, the heart<br />
of Mexico.<br />

From Strategy to Action!<br />
Pedro Pinho (Improvement Agent, Packaging Portugal) conducted<br />
the session “From Strategy to Action!” at the job fair<br />
“StartPoint” in the University of Minho. The aim of the session<br />
was to present the Packaging Division’s business model<br />
of continuous improvement, in an attempt to strengthen<br />
bonds with the students.<br />
Entitled “Colep Packaging Business System” (CPBS), the<br />
model began its implementation in 2014 and is a clear reflection<br />
of our intention to be constantly innovate and add<br />
value to our business. Targeting the growth of a continuous<br />
improvement attitude, the commitment with more complex<br />
and global projects and the creation of a culture of excellence<br />
within the company; the model intends to develop<br />
the foundations for daily management and Lean leadership.<br />
The CPBS has four crucial cornerstones which interact<br />
with each other and are responsible for the viability of daily<br />
changes in all hierarchical levels: the “Leaders”, the “Daily<br />
Management”, the “Project” and the “Support”.<br />
Finally, another key element of this model is the commitment<br />
to continuous training of our employees. The CPBS<br />
also aims at raising awareness towards sustainability issues,<br />
for fighting the feeling of acceptance, for achieving excellence<br />
in our daily work and for creating value for our customers.<br />
Visioning the model’s global implementation and consolidation<br />
throughout all Packaging areas, the main focus for now<br />
is the industrial area as the agents are working to create a<br />
bottom-up flow of information.<br />
We have received very positive feedback from the students<br />
who attended the session, who contacted us demonstrating<br />
interest in our company.<br />
As it is said by the Continuous Improvement<br />
team members, the operational excellence is<br />
not nice to have, but a must have.<br />

COMMUNITY<br />
Colep presents Sustainable Cosmetis in Paris!<br />
Raquel Teixeira (Corporate Sustainability Manager) and<br />
Michele Del Grosso (Sustainability Expert at Aptar) presented<br />
at the Sustainable Cosmetics Summit in Paris from 24th<br />
to 26th October 20<strong>16</strong>.<br />
The presentation “Life Cycle Assessment of Aerosols with<br />
different dispensing technologies” introduced the recent<br />
project undertaken by Aptar and Colep when they carried<br />
out the Life Cycle Assessment (LCA) studies to evaluate the<br />
environmental impact of different products using the different<br />
valve technologies and propellants. The presentation<br />
also showed the potential to run LCA studies within business<br />
activities.<br />

LOOKING INSIDE FOR BEST PRACTICES<br />
Sharing Knowledge<br />
“Technical webinars” is a project of Marketing and Innovation<br />
department - online presentation provided monthly via<br />
Skype by M&I members from around the world to ourselves<br />
and other interested parties/departments. By using this<br />
tool, knowledge is distributed worldwide in an easy manner,<br />
we share the information and experience between each<br />
other, which is especially useful in terms of new technologies<br />
or product categories.<br />
Webinars are divided into three phases:<br />
. 1A (theoretical part – basics);<br />
. 1B (theoretical part – advanced);<br />
. 2 (practical part – ie. scale-up);<br />
. Presentation lasts 1 hour and covers one chosen topic<br />
such as Body Spray, Antiperspirants, Sun Care, etc., at the<br />
time.<br />
They are scheduled until the end of 20<strong>16</strong> and planned to<br />
continue in 2017 with new topics as innovations will come.<br />

LOOKING INSIDE FOR BEST PRACTICES<br />
Project ”Valorização”<br />
20<strong>16</strong> has been special for the Aerosol unit in Brazil, in special<br />
due to the consistent results from the turnaround project,<br />
started in 2015.<br />
The company mobilized all efforts and worked hard to reverse<br />
a difficult situation, which consisted of instable results<br />
in productivity, costs, safety, quality and no profits since<br />
started its operations in 2012.<br />
In 2015, the management team launched the project “Valorização”<br />
(“Enhancement” in Portuguese).<br />
Initially oriented by consulting services, and with support<br />
from Colep worldwide, they mapped out the main issues,<br />
defined critical projects, implemented an information system<br />
and KPIs, took corrective actions, and intensified training,<br />
resulting in:<br />
• Zero LTA since April 2015;<br />
• 99% level of attendance to the production plan;<br />
• OEE increased to an average level of 70%.<br />
Congratulations to the team in Brazil for the outstanding<br />
results!<br />

PEOPLE DEVELOPMENT<br />
Developing our People is one of our strategies for success!<br />
The People Development Cycle (PDC) involves a<br />
formal, structured system of measuring and evaluating job<br />
related behaviours and outcomes. Furthermore, it allows<br />
for a progressive alignment between the careers path of<br />
each employee and Colep’s expectations and a sustainable<br />
development of our internal talent.<br />
The PDC is mainly focused on functions with management<br />
responsibility and technical expertise.<br />
This strategic tool assumes several main objectives with<br />
operational and global implications:<br />
• Align employees’ behaviour and goals with the organisation’s<br />
Values, Goals and Strategy;<br />
• Clarify job responsibilities and expectations;<br />
• Enhance individual and group performance;<br />
• Provide an overview of employees’ performance and<br />
potential within all locations and divisions;<br />
• Manage employees’ skills and competencies to foster<br />
their maximum potential in a high-performance<br />
culture;<br />
• Manage succession planning for the entire organisation<br />
and especially for key functions;<br />
• Define measures and tools to support the development<br />
of our employees;<br />
The PDC has 2 steps illustrated through different colours:<br />
the green that refers to the Annual Performance Perspective<br />
(short-term) and the blue identifying Career Management<br />
Perspective (long-term).<br />
In each cycle within the Annual Performance Perspective,<br />
we evaluate the alignment between the Colep’s Value<br />
and Competencies and those of each employee and the<br />
direct manager. In this phase each employee’s career ambitions<br />
are registered on the system to be considered on the<br />
individual development plan or in new opportunities in the<br />
company.<br />
The Career Management Perspective involves our Managers<br />
inputs related to Sustainable Performance and Potential of<br />
each employee.<br />
This is a critical process for each person’s career development,<br />
for the success of our operations and for the company’s<br />
results.<br />
